Singapore Automotive Composite Body Panel Market Insights

  • As highlighted in RedlinePulse analysis, the Singapore Automotive Composite Body Panel Market, worth USD 33.54 Million in 2025, is forecasted to achieve USD 67.95 Million by 2034.
  • The Singapore market is anticipated to grow at a CAGR of 8.2% during the period 2026–2034.
  • By 2025, Carbon Fiber Reinforced Polymer (CFRP) represented the largest share of the By Material Type market size.
  • Glass Fiber Reinforced Polymer (GFRP) is expected to remain the key growth driver within By Material Type, registering the fastest CAGR during the forecast period.
